On Tuesday, he marked the second international trip to Alsia since he became a provisional leader in Syria, who met Saudi Crown Prince Mohamed Bin Salman earlier this week.
Alshala led the Hayat Tahalil Al Sham (HTS) rebellion group in December, which discouraged the government of Syria’s long -standing leader Bashal Al Asado.
At a press conference in Ankala, Erdogan will be preparing to partner with Syria’s new leadership when he will fight against Arsia, especially in Northeast Syria, and the Kurdish fighter. He said he was done.
“I would like to express our satisfaction with the strong commitment that my brother, Arshalas, in the battle with terrorism,” said Erdogan.
“I told Alshala that I was ready to provide the necessary support for Syria in the battle with all kinds of terrorism, whether I was Daesh or PKK,” he said, “he added, and ISIL and Kurdistan. I mentioned the Labor Party Arabic early language. 。
Torquie, who share the border with Syria, regards the Syrian Kurdish group near the southern border as a “terrorist.” These include PKK and the People’s Protection Unit (YPG).
YPG accounts for most of the Kurdish -led Syrian Democratic (SDF) supported by the United States, which controls the large -scale band in the northeast of Syria.
SDF is an important alliance fighting Syria’s US -led Union. However, since Al Assad’s collapse, Turkish officials have been pushing to take over surgery.

Defense, immigration, trade
Alshala said that his government had called for a “strategic partnership” with Torque as he invited Erdogan to visit Syria “on the earliest opportunity.”
The statement emphasized a major reorganization of the area, and Ankara cut off his relationship with Damascus in 2011 after the outbreak of Syria’s civil war. Turkiye opposed Al-Assad through conflict.
“We are working on the construction of a strategic partnership with Turkiye to confront the threat of local security to guarantee the permanent security and stability of Syria and Torquie.” He said.
He added that the pair has discussed “threats to prevent territorial unification in northeastern Syria”. Alshala rejected the Kulds’s autonomy of all forms and urged SDF to hand over weapons.
Koseoglu reported that the two leaders have also discussed a new defense agreement, which has been widely reported. Turkiye was able to see TURKIYE establishing a new base in Syria, beyond what already exists along the border of Turkiye.
“There is still a military base established within the past few years to protect the border from PKK and YPG attacks. They haven’t shut down,” Koseglu said. “But they are talking about new military bases.
Following the meeting, Erdogan pledged to continue to call for international sanctions imposed on Syria during the Al -Asado rules. The relief from sanctions was Alshala’s top priority because he has been active in the last few weeks.
Erdogan added that it is important to support the new Damascus government during the migration period.
Regarding the issue of Syrian refugees and immigrants, Erdogan believes that the spontaneous return of the Syrian will increase the pace because the country is more stable.
Turkiye hosted the maximum number of Syrian refugees after the outbreak of the Syrian civil war in 2011 and after the peak of 2022 after the outbreak of more than 3.8 million.
This pair also discussed economic connections. This is what Turkish transport companies and manufacturers are more and more likely to expand Syria.
